Here are just a few tips to keep in mind as you’re considering which colors to choose for your baseball jerseys and custom apparel:
DO Consider Powder Blue:
Powder blue uniforms have a classic and timeless appeal. They can give your team a distinct and stylish look that stands out on the field. Consider incorporating powder blue elements into your jerseys or pants for a fresh and eye-catching design.
DON'T Go With All-Black:
While all-black uniforms may seem sleek and modern, they can absorb heat and become uncomfortable, especially during hot summer games. It's best to avoid all-black uniforms to ensure the comfort and performance of your players.
DON'T Go All-White, Either:
Similarly, all-white uniforms may look crisp and clean, but they can easily show dirt and stains. Additionally, they may be distracting for the opposing team's batters due to the bright contrast against the field. Opt for a combination of colors or incorporate accents to avoid the pitfalls of all-white uniforms.
DO Consider Grey Jerseys:
Grey jerseys are a popular choice for baseball teams as they offer a neutral base that complements various colors and designs. They also provide a classic and professional look that never goes out of style.
Tips for Styling Up Your Baseball Custom Apparel via Graphics, Letters, etc.:
DO Consider Pinstripes:
Pinstripes are synonymous with baseball and can add a touch of tradition and elegance to your uniforms. They create a visually appealing pattern and give your team a classic and refined appearance.
DON'T Utilize Over-The-Top Graphics:
While incorporating graphics can enhance the visual appeal of your uniforms, it's crucial to strike the right balance. Avoid using excessive or distracting graphics that may take away from the overall aesthetic. Keep it clean, simple, and tasteful.
DO Consider Printing Numbers and Player Names:
Printing numbers and player names on the back of jerseys adds a professional touch and helps identify each player easily. Ensure the font and size are legible from a distance, making it convenient for spectators and coaches.
DO Consider Script Fonts:
Script fonts can add a touch of elegance and sophistication to your team's name or player names. They create a unique and stylish look that stands out on the field. However, make sure the script font is easily readable and doesn't compromise clarity.
